Summary of differences between macadamia and potato pancake
- Macadamia has more manganese, vitamin B1, copper, iron, magnesium, and fiber, while potato pancake has more vitamin C.
- Macadamia covers your daily need for manganese, 168% more than potato pancake.
- Macadamia contains 8 times more vitamin B1 than potato pancake. While macadamia contains 1.195mg of vitamin B1, potato pancake contains only 0.158mg.
- The amount of saturated fat in potato pancake is lower.
These are the specific foods used in this comparison Nuts, macadamia nuts, raw and Potato pancakes.
